Easy Bisquick Strawberry Shortcake Recipe

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Total Time 32 minutes
Servings 6 servings
Calories 350
Enjoy a classic dessert with this easy Bisquick strawberry shortcake recipe. Fresh strawberries and whipped cream atop a fluffy shortcake make for a delightful treat.

Ingredients

Shortcake

  • 2 1/3 cups Bisquick mix
  • 1/2 cup Milk (Whole milk preferred)
  • 3 tbsp Sugar
  • 3 tbsp Butter (Melted)
  • 1/2 tsp Vanilla extract (Optional, but adds flavor)

Strawberry Topping

  • 4 cups Strawberries (Fresh, sliced)
  • 1/4 cup Granulated sugar (Adjust based on berry sweetness)
  • 1 tbsp Lemon juice (Optional but highly recommended)

Whipped Cream

  • 1 cup Heavy whipping cream (Chilled)
  • 2 tbsp Powdered sugar
  • 1/2 tsp Vanilla extract (Optional)
  • Mint leaves (Optional garnish)

Instructions 

  • Prepare and macerate strawberries with sugar and lemon juice.
  •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C) and prepare baking sheet.
  • Combine Bisquick, sugar, milk, butter, and vanilla to form dough.
  • Drop dough onto baking sheet using spoon or scoop.
  • Bake shortcakes until golden brown (10–12 minutes).
  • Let shortcakes cool on rack after baking.
  • Whip cream with sugar and vanilla to soft peaks.
  • Slice shortcakes horizontally with serrated knife.
  • Add strawberries and whipped cream to bottom half.
  • Place top half of shortcake, add more cream and garnish.
